Abstract :
This paper deals with the problem of nonlinear dynamics of a system of coupled phase-locked loop and delay-lock loop interacting through crossed feedback. Stability of regime of synchronization and the behaviour of the system at the boundaries of stability region are studied. Possible scenarios of the evolution of nonsynchronous regimes as a function of system parameters are found. Strong dependence of nonsynchronous regimes on control circuits parameters is found.
